Redis过期机制明晃晃的业务前景(redis过期对业务影响)
Redis是全球最受欢迎、最流行的内存数据库。它提供了一种高性能键值(key-value)存储系统,能够快速地读取和存储数据,使得应用程序能够更快地响应客户端的请求。它的过期机制使用的是一个简单的设置范围,比如要求一个key的存在时间必须小于等于某个特定的最长时间,如果超时,就会被删除。
Redis过期机制为业务提供了更多的可能性,并带来了明显的前景。Redis的过期机制可以通过设置一个定时器来清理缓存,从而节省大量的内存空间。可以使用Redis的过期机制来管理一个缓存池,以便在特定的时间段有效地管理缓存。而且,依托于过期机制,Redis还能支持多重缓存,减少数据库的压力,从而提高应用的性能。
与此同时,Redis的过期机制还可以用于定期更新淘汰缓存中的一些过期数据,减少缓存占用的空间,从而优化系统性能,提高工作效率。同样重要的是,Redis的过期机制还可以简化应用程序开发,例如,用于临时令牌生成的应用,可以在服务器端设置一个定时器,将过期的令牌自动触发删除。
将Redis的过期机制应用到业务场景中,可以帮助企业实现更高效率和更低重复率的目标,实现更快更可靠的服务。所以,Redis的过期机制有着很好的业务前景,可以有效提高企业的运营效率,使企业取得良好的业务绩效。
示例代码:
// 为key “key”设置过期时间为30秒
redis.expire(“key”, 30);
// 获取key “key”的剩余过期时间
redis.ttl(“key”);